Research On The Relationship Between Urban Transit Desert And Built Environment Using Multi-source Data

Since the reform and opening up,with the rapid development of China’s economic and social development,the level of urban motorization has been significantly improved,resulting in a series of problems such as traffic congestion,air pollution and energy shortage increasingly prominent.In recent years,giving priority to the development of urban public transportation has become an important way to solve these urban problems.With the goal of improving the quality of urban public transportation services,exploring the mechanism of urban transit desert formation has gradually become a research hotspot in urban planning.From the perspective of public transportation demand and supply,this paper takes the main urban area of Wuhan as the research scope to identify urban transit desert area based on multi-source data and studies the influence of urban built environment factors on transit desert and puts forward corresponding improvement strategies.Firstly,based on the OD data of mobile phone signaling,the public transportation demand is calculated.The supply capacity of public transportation is quantified by selecting four indexes of urban public transport station density,line density,service frequency and transport capacity.By calculating the difference between the demand and the supply capacity of public transportation,the transit desert area in the main urban area of Wuhan is identified.Secondly,through the construction of binary Logistic model,the correlation between urban transit desert and urban built environment elements is quantitatively analyzed,and the root and dynamic mechanism of urban transit desert are explored.The results show that the transit deserts in Wuhan are mainly distributed in the area of the third ring road of the main urban area.According to the spatial distribution,they can be classified into three types: historical center urban agglomeration,distribution along urban trunk road and distribution along urban ring road.The regression results confirm that there is a significant correlation between the transit desert and the urban built environment in Wuhan,and different urban built environment factors have different influences on the formation of transit desert.The surrounding areas of high-grade commercial facilities and public service facilities,high-density recreational facilities and residential areas,highintensity development land and the surrounding areas of high-density urban roads are more likely to form urban transit desert.In addition,the unbalanced distribution of jobs and housing is also one of the main factors leading to the creation urban transit desert.Finally,based on the current situation of urban built environment elements and from the perspective of the balance between supply and demand of public transportation,this paper puts forward targeted optimization strategies for different types of transit desert in Wuhan.This study complements and improves the relevant studies on the quantification method of public transit desert identification and its influence mechanism,and provides technical support for the development of urban public transport and the optimization of urban land use layout.
